you are absolutely 100% on the money in that the S8000 is the hands down,kick ass winner of all three mentioned. So much thought had gone into the sherwood from copper cladding on parts of the chassis, to the buss bar ground,to the 6eu7 tubes used, and to the class they ran the output tubes in, was all SUPERB!!!!.
All anyone has to do is listen to a nice up to snuff,S-8000,and that will end your search for looking for a better receiver. Nuf Said!!
One more receiver I am really fond of is the HK Festival,HK260. Even tho it has a doubler,the layout is very nice and I like the way the controls are mounted away from everything. It always has very very nice iron!!
